A care services provider in Ealing is looking for a dedicated Care Coordinator to organize care services and manage staff. The role involves coordinating care, supervising care workers, and liaising with professionals. Ideal candidates will have experience in healthcare, strong organizational skills, and a passion for community care. This position offers a competitive salary and the chance to make a meaningful difference in the community.
